    ps4 targeting with controller

    right now i have three targeting options all enemies and custom. is there a way to turn off all and enemies and just use my custom one

    You switch between the filters with L1+ faceplate buttons on right, you can also set separate filters on sheated/unsheated weapon.

    Go into your options, somewhere (I forget which tab) there is one that is a check box of things for targeting. Check everything for when your weapon is sheathed and check only, enemies, aggroing enemies for when your weapon is unsheathed. That'll help you a ton. If you're a healer then check party members and non-party members while weapon is unsheathed also.

    I take it that's with the L1 + faceplate buttons? You can have up to four settings there, one for each of the four right-hand faceplate buttons, Triangle, Square, X, and O. Any of the four can be individually enabled or disabled and can be configured to include whatever types of targets you want them to. (I'd recommend keeping one of them set to "ALL" though, whatever else you usually use.) It's under Character Configuration, Filters tab.

    You can either do one or the other, but they'll interfere with each other if you try to set both. If you want the L1 + faceplate options, then turn off the option for sheathed/unsheathed filters, and vice versa.
